Who this is for

This workshop is designed for people who have responsibility for generating business but don't necessarily think of themselves as salespeople.

  • Owners & ProfessionalsCarrying revenue responsibility while focused on a different core craft.
  • Team MembersExpected to develop relationships, follow up, and bring in business.
  • Rising LeadersDiscovering that the next level of success means learning how to develop business.

The workshop is partly about practical business-development skills, but April also gets into the mindsets and stories we tell ourselves that can keep us from doing the things we know we need to do.

She'll talk about things like confidence, prospecting, understanding client needs, follow-up, and the habits of top producers.
